Potato Halwa Sweet

👌Easy🍰Dessert🍿Snack🥬Vegetarian

Ready in

35 mins

Cuisine

Indian · South Asian

Prep Time

15 min

Cook Time

20 min

Serving

4 People

Calories / Serving

~500 kcal
Recipe by Food Recipes on YouTube

Summary

  • A unique and delicious sweet dish made from mashed potatoes, cooked with sugar and oil, then garnished with almonds and tutti frutti. This halwa offers a delightful blend of textures and flavors, perfect as a dessert or a sweet treat.

All Ingredients - Main Ingredients

  1. Potatoes 500 grams (boiled and mashed)
  2. Cooking oil 1/4 cup
  3. Sugar powder 1/2 cup
  4. Almonds 3 tablespoons (sliced)
  5. Tutti frutti 2 tablespoons

🍳Tools You'll Need

  • Frying pan
  • Pan
  • Bowl
  • Spatula

⚠ Contains Allergens

Tree Nuts

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1: Prepare Potatoes

Boil the potatoes until tender, then peel and mash them well in a bowl using a potato masher or fork.

Step 2: Heat Oil

Add cooking oil to a frying pan and heat it well over medium heat.

Step 3: Cook Mashed Potatoes

Add the mashed potatoes to the hot oil in the frying pan. Cook them, stirring continuously with a spatula, until they turn light brown and slightly separated, which should take about .

Step 4: Add Sugar Powder

Once the potatoes have turned light brown, add the sugar powder to the pan.

Step 5: Mix and Cook

Mix the sugar powder thoroughly with the potatoes. Continue to cook for another , stirring constantly, until the sugar is fully incorporated and the mixture thickens.

Step 6: Add Almonds and Tutti Frutti

Add 2 tablespoons of sliced almonds and 2 tablespoons of tutti frutti to the halwa. Mix them in well.

Step 7: Final Cooking

Continue to cook and mix for another until all ingredients are well combined and the halwa reaches a desired consistency. Turn off the flame.

Step 8: Serve Halwa

Dish out the potato halwa onto a serving plate.

Step 9: Garnish

Garnish the potato halwa with the remaining sliced almonds before serving.

Pro Tips

• Ensure potatoes are mashed thoroughly for a smooth halwa.

• Adjust sugar quantity according to your preference.

• Cook the potatoes on medium heat to prevent burning and ensure even browning.

• You can add cardamom powder for extra flavor.

• Garnish with other nuts like pistachios or cashews if desired.

Variations

• Add a pinch of saffron for color and aroma.

• Incorporate a small amount of milk powder for a richer taste.

• Use ghee instead of cooking oil for a more traditional flavor.
